Transaction e389028bd73e38a0a7c129a6680d81bf0b494b8350b052e2419b3c651c5af989

block
3379cb24a5301030a517b81d28eb896bab6c267b5cb2fa89a98f36139823e1df

2 Inputs

2 Outputs